Lauryn Przeslawski, DO, discusses what couples should expect on their pregnancy journey, including tips for planning, morning sickness and other symptoms, and fertility concerns.

In the episode, Dr. Przeslawski answers the following:

1) We all know it's important to plan for pregnancy even before you're actually pregnant. For listeners who may be planning to start a family soon, what advice can you share?
2) Before taking a pregnancy test for confirmation, what are early symptoms of pregnancy?
3) We've heard stories about terrible morning sickness during the first trimester of pregnancy. What are some of the changes pregnant women may experience during the first trimester, and how can they minimize any discomfort?
4) What foods or activities should be avoided in early pregnancy?
5) What about couples who are struggling to get pregnant? Is there anything they should be doing, or not doing, to help increase the likelihood of pregnancy? How do you know when it's time to see a doctor?
6) Tell us about the first prenatal visit. What's included in the examination and what questions should women ask during the first prenatal visit?
